From port of Salva to beach tavellera Introduction
From port of Salva to beach tavellera is a 3.6 mile (8,000-step) route located near El Port de la Selva, Spain. This route has an elevation gain of about 911.8 ft and is rated as hard. Find the best walking trails near you in Pacer App.